How much do you tip the cake maker at a wedding?

"Couples do not have tip their wedding cake baker, though they can tip the delivery team who sets up the wedding cake display at the reception," Chertoff said. "$10 to $25 is typically acceptable, $50 if the display is over the top and takes a long time to arrange."

Do you tip your wedding DJ?

Here's a general guideline: Ceremony Musicians: 15% of the ceremony music fee or $15–$25 per musician. Reception Band: $25–$50 per musician. DJ: 10–15% of the total bill or $50–$150.

Do you tip the photographer at a wedding?

Photographer and Videographer

As a general rule, it's not necessary to tip the owner of the company (which wedding photographers often are), though you could tip $100 or more if you feel so inclined. If there is an assistant, tip the assistant $50 to $75.

How much do you tip a hairdresser for $250?

Remember the golden rule: "You should tip 20 percent on the entire service cost, not per individual," says Schweitzer. So if your haircut and blow-dry cost $40 total, and your color was $60, your total service cost comes to $100. That means you should tip $20 divided between the colorist and stylist.

What is the tip for a 100 dollar bill?

A Simple Trick to Calculate the Tip

Take the total bill and double it in your head, then shift the decimal point to the left one place. This will be a 20% tip amount. For example, on a $100 bill, double the bill in your head – the result is $200. Then move the decimal point one place to the left, which is $20.0.

How much do you tip a photo booth attendant?

Photo booth rental

If they're going to be very hands-on and involved in the photo process, $30-$50 each is good. If they're just there to set it up and take it away, $15-$20 each is fine.

Do you tip before or after tax?

Some will suggest tip amounts based on the total bill, but most suggest tips based on the pre-tax total. That's the correct answer: you don't tip on the tax, because tax is not a service the restaurant provided.
